How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Red Oak?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Red Oak Studio Apartments | $1,255 | $895 | $1,560 |
| Red Oak 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,391 | $670 | $1,770 |
| Red Oak 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,671 | $825 | $2,400 |
| Red Oak 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,845 | $900 | $3,197 |
| Red Oak 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,353 | $1,505 | $2,916 |
